Ingredients

For the Slaw

  • 4 cups green cabbage, shredded
  • 1 cup carrots, grated
  • ½ cup dill pickles, chopped
  • ¼ cup red onion, thinly sliced

For the Dressing

  • ½ cup mayonnaise (or Greek yogurt)
  • 2 tbsp Sriracha sauce
  • 1 tbsp honey
  •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ar

How to Make Sweet & Spicy Pickle Slaw

Step 1: Prep the Vegetables

Start by shredding the cabbage and grating the carrots. In a large mixing bowl, combine them with the chopped pickles and thinly sliced red onion.

Step 2: Make the Dressing

In another b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ise (or Greek yogurt), Sriracha sauce, honey, and apple cider vinegar until smooth.

Step 3: Combine

Pour the dressing over the vegetable mixture. Toss everything well until all ingredients are evenly coated in the delicious dressing.

Step 4: Chill

Cover the slaw with plastic wrap or a lid. Refrigerate for at least one hour to allow flavors to meld together nicely.

Step 5: Serve

Before serving, give the slaw another toss to ensure it’s mixed well. Enjoy this delightful Sweet & Spicy Pickle Slaw alongside your favorite dishes!

How to Perfect Sweet & Spicy Pickle Slaw

For the best Sweet & Spicy Pickle Slaw, consider these helpful tips to enhance flavor and texture.

  • Fresh Ingredients: Always use fresh cabbage and vegetables for the best crunch and flavor.
  • Customize Heat Level: Adjust the amount of Sriracha based on your spice preference; you can even add jalapeños for an extra kick.
  • Let It Chill: Allow the slaw to chill in the refrigerator for at least one hour; this helps flavors meld beautifully.
  • Mix Well: Ensure all ingredients are well combined so every bite is flavorful.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Sweet & Spicy Pickle Slaw, avoiding common pitfalls can enhance the flavor and texture of your dish. Here are some mistakes to watch out for:

  • Over-salting: Adding too much salt can overpower the flavors. Use just enough salt to enhance the taste of the vegetables.

  • Skipping the chill time: Not allowing the slaw to chill means missing out on flavor development. Refrigerate for at least one hour for best results.

  • Using low-quality ingredients: Cheap mayonnaise or pickles can affect overall taste. Opt for fresh, high-quality ingredients for a more delicious slaw.

  • Ignoring texture: Cutting vegetables unevenly can lead to an inconsistent bite. Make sure to shred and slice evenly for a uniform crunch.

  • Not tasting before serving: Failing to taste may result in an unbalanced slaw. Always sample your slaw after mixing to adjust seasoning as needed.
